PROTECT FROM LIGHT. HYGROSCOPIC. PACKAGED UNDER INERT GAS. A cell-permeable phenylpropylamine derived anti-depressant that acts as a selective serotonin re-uptake inhibitor (SSRI). Reported to modulate the proliferation of T-cells by increasing the Ca2+ influx and thereby influencing the activities of protein kinase A (PKA) and protein kinase C (PKC). Also shown to regulate the phosphorylation of DARPP-32 (dopamine-and cAMP-regulated phosphoprotein of Mr 32,000) and AMPA (a-amino-3-hydroxy-5-methyl-4-isoxazolepropionic acid) receptors. Shown to trigger oxidative stress-induced apoptotic cell death. Also reported to initiate signaling pathways in neuronal cells leading to activation of ERK and NF-kB. Purity: ≥98% by HPLC.
